Making local online changes in an XRF complex

In the IMS™ DB/DC and DCCTL XRF environments, in addition to preparing the staging libraries, you need to prepare the inactive libraries.

If an XRF takeover occurs while the active IMS is processing a /MODIFY COMMIT command, the change might or might not have occurred. At the end of an online change, IMS writes a log record; the XRF alternate subsystem reads the log and makes the online changes to match the changes on the active subsystem. Use the /DISPLAY DB or QUERY DB command to check that a change occurred on the alternate subsystem.
